What is the difference between gelato and ice cream? Know the real difference between the two
Nowadays, there is a lot of confusion among dessert lovers regarding “gelato” and “ice cream”. Both are cold and sweet things, but there is a big difference in their preparation method, taste and texture. Let us understand what is the difference between gelato and ice cream.
Gelato is a traditional dessert of Italy, while ice cream is more popular in America and Europe. The main ingredients of both are milk, sugar and flavours, but there is a big difference in their proportions.
Gelato contains more milk and less cream, whereas ice cream has more cream. For this reason, gelato has less fat and appears lighter. Whereas ice cream feels creamier and heavier.
The second big difference is air content. Gelato is mixed at a slow speed, which allows for less air to be added. Because of this its texture is dense and smooth. On the other hand, more air is added to ice cream, making it fluffy and light.
There is a difference in terms of taste also. Gelato tastes more intense and natural because it contains less fat, allowing the flavor to reach the taste buds directly. Due to high fat in ice cream, the taste becomes a bit mild but it gives a more creamy feel.
There is also a difference in temperature—gelato is served at a slightly warmer temperature, while ice cream is much colder.
Overall, gelato is better if you prefer lighter and stronger flavors, and ice cream is the right choice if you want a creamier and richer dessert.
